Chicken Scampi

This Chicken Scampi recipe combines lightly breaded and pan-fried chicken tenderloins with a creamy, seasoned sauce made from butter, garlic, onion, chicken broth, Italian herbs, and cream. Alongside sautéed bell peppers and red onions, it's served over angel hair pasta with Parmesan and fresh parsley garnish for a complete meal.

Description

Chicken Scampi involves preparing a savory sauce by sautéing minced onion and garlic in butter, then simmering it with chicken broth and Italian seasoning to infuse flavor. After simmering, heavy cream is added to create a rich, smooth sauce that gently thickens without boiling.

Chicken tenderloins are seasoned, dusted with flour, and pan-fried until golden and fully cooked. Bell peppers and red onions are julienned and sautéed separately in the same skillet, adding sweet, tender vegetable components to the dish.

The freshly boiled angel hair pasta is combined or served alongside the chicken and vegetables, all topped with grated Parmesan and optionally fresh parsley for brightness. The finishing touches balance creamy, herby sauce with tender chicken and crisp-tender vegetables over delicate pasta strands.

Leftovers can be refrigerated in airtight containers for a few days or frozen for longer storage, making it a practical meal to prepare in advance or keep on hand.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 3 tbs butter
  • 2 tbs onion minced
  • 1 tsp garlic minced
  • 1 1/2 cups chicken broth
  • 1/2 tsp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 tsp salt fine sea sal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• 1/2 tsp red pepper flakes
  • 1 tbs parsley dried
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 16 oz angel hair pasta
  • 1 lb chicken tenderloin about 9-12 pieces
  • salt
  • black pepper
  • 1 cup flour
  • 4 tbs olive oil
  • 2 bell pepper red
  • 1 red onions
  • 1 tbsp Parmesan Cheese freshly grated
  • 1 tbsp parsley freshly chopped, optional garnish

Instructions

  1. In a medium sized sauce pan add butter, minced onion, minced garlic and saute over medium heat for a 1-2 minutes. Don't let the garlic burn! Add in chicken broth, Italian seasoning, salt, pepper, red pepper flakes and the dried parsley. Simmer for 15 minutes on med-low heat.
  2. After 15 minutes is up add heavy whipping cream and simmer on low, without boiling for 10 minutes.
  3. In a separate pot, boil the angel hair pasta according to the directions on the box.
  4. To prepare your chicken tenders, sprinkle with salt and pepper and dip in flour. Fry in a skillet over medium heat with a couple tablespoons of olive oil 3-5 minutes on each side until golden brown and cooked all the way through. Set aside.
  5. Take your onions and bell peppers and cut in julienne strips, making sure to remove all seeds and the white membrane on the inside. In the same skillet that the chicken was cooked in, add another tablespoon or so of olive oil and saute the onions and bell peppers. I cook on high for 3-5 minutes until they get soft and caramelized.
  6. Take the creamy garlic sauce and add half of it to the pasta. Stir to incorporate sauce.
  7. Add all the onions and bell peppers and mix into the pasta. Dish up pasta, adding the chicken on top. Drizzle more sauce over pasta and chicken. Garnish with freshly grated Parmesan cheese and parsley if desired.

Notes

  • Store leftovers in airtight containers in the refrigerator for 3-4 days.
  • For extended preservation, freeze in sealed, freezer-safe containers or bags for up to two months.
